Crisis Stabilization and Community Reentry Act of 2020

Crisis Stabilization and Community Reentry Act of 2020

This bill authorizes the Department of Justice to award grants for states, Native American tribes, local governments, and community-based nonprofit organizations to provide clinical services for people with serious mental illness and substance use disorders who need mental health services upon release from a correctional facility.

Became Public Law No: 116-281.
